Decoding KCET Merit Lists
The integration of CET scores with thePES University Cut-Off determines the accessibility of merit-based seats for local residential candidates.
- State-level ranks are calculated based on a combination of entrance exam performance and qualifying board marks.
- The PES University Cut-Off for KCET candidates is often more competitive than other private engineering colleges.
- Students must participate in multiple rounds of KEA counseling to secure a seat in the top-tier branches.
- Ranks within the top two thousand are generally required for the most popular engineering specializations.
